Solución ecuaciones 2x2 con R
Автор: MathJeasy
Загружено: 2021-10-29
Просмотров: 1348
#softwareR #lenguajeR #ecuaciones #MathJeasy
En este video se muestra la forma de correr un script para resolver un sistema de ecuaciones de 2x2 así como generar su gráfica en 3D empleando el software R. ¡Es muy fácil y el software es libre!
#####################################################
ScripT. SOLUCIÓN DE SISTEMAS DE ECUACIONES 2x2
# Resolver el sistema de 2 ecuaciones lineales con 2 incógnitas usando la
librería solve
#
1x - 2y = 7 ec. 1
5x - 7y = -5 ec. 2
# Cada ecuación corresponde a una línea en el espacio 2D.
Las ecuaciones tienen una solución única si las dos líneas cruzan en un punto.
###########
Paso 1. Intalar librería (sólo se requiere instalar una ocasión)
install.packages("matlib")
library(matlib) # Leer librería (se requiere en cada ocasión que se corra el script)
###########
Paso 2. Construir matriz A con coeficientes de x, y.
R comienza a leer por renglón
A = matrix(c (1, -2,
5, -7),
nrow = 2, ncol = 2,
byrow=TRUE) # R comienza a leer por renglón
colnames(A) = paste0('x', 1:2)
A # imprimir en consola la matriz A
###########
Paso 3. Construir matriz b con coeficientes
b=c(2, -5)
b # imprimir en consola el vector b
###########
Paso 4.1 Resolver el sistema de ecuaciones con solve
solucion=solve(A,b)
solucion
###########
Paso 4.2 Resolver el sistema de ecuaciones con echelom
Coloca la solución con matriz escalonada
echelon(A, b, verbose=TRUE, fractions=TRUE)
###########
Paso 5. Generar la gráfica de los planos en el espacio 3D de cada ecuación
así como el punto de intersección si existe.
plotEqn(A,b, xlim=c(-10,-7), ylim=c(-8,-3), labels=TRUE)
Доступные форматы для скачивания:
Скачать видео mp4
-
Информация по загрузке: